摘要
文章对已有的几种平面度测量方法进行分析,并结合实际情况提出了滚轮胎架法、转轴连杆法、试压工装法、等高块法4种法兰与筒节焊接后的密封面平面度测量方案。经比较分析将转轴连杆法和等高块法相结合形成一种较为实用的新型密封面平面度测量方案,并利用轴承实现转动连续测量。通过百分表测出密封面各处平面度大小,验证了新测量方案的可行性。
        Several kinds of flatness measurement method were analyzed in this paper. Combined with the actual situation, four measurment methods of flange and shell ring sealing surface after welding were proposed. They were rolling tyre frame method, rotary shaft connecting rod method, pressure test method and equal height method. The combination of rotary shaft connecting rod method and equal height block method formed a new practical plan to measure the flatness of the sealing surface, and measurement of continuous rotation was realized by using the bearing. The feasibility of the new measurement method was verified by measuring the flatness of each part of the sealing surface with a dial indicator.
